#f15267 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f15267 is composed of 94.5% red, 32.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 352.1 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 63.3%. #f15267 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ce with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f15267 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f15267 has RGB values of R:241, G:82,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.57,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15815271.

Shades and Tints of #f15267
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080102 is the darkest color, while #fef5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f15267
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a1a1 is the less saturated color, while #f84b62 is the most saturated one.
